All-Aboard is a Watersports Charity. Our aim is to break down barriers and make it possible for everyone in our community to participate in a range of watersports such as sailing, kayaking, canoeing, rowing, paddle boarding, powerboating and other water-related activities. SO:Let's Connect
SO:Let’s Connect is a new project aiming to reduce isolation by getting more people connected digitally.
